The function of a furnace fan limit switch is to regulate the temperature inside the furnace. It helps control when the fan turns on and off based on the temperature of the air inside the furnace. If the switch is not working properly, it can cause the fan to run continuously or not turn on at all, which can lead to overheating or inefficient heating in the furnace.
A limit switch on a furnace is a safety device that monitors the temperature inside the furnace. If the temperature gets too high, the limit switch will shut off the furnace to prevent overheating and potential damage.

The temperature of a furnace can be measured using a thermocouple, which is a temperature sensor that produces a voltage proportional to the temperature. The thermocouple is placed inside the furnace and the voltage output is converted to a temperature reading by a controller or thermometer.
The fan limit switch in a furnace controls when the fan turns on and off based on the temperature inside the furnace. It regulates the operation of the fan by monitoring the temperature and activating the fan when the furnace reaches a certain temperature and turning it off when the temperature decreases.
